Nate Clark ‘57

 

A tailback who broke barriers and shattered records for the Dales in the 1950s, Nate Clark’s name is prominent in the Hillsdale College record books more than 50 years after his graduation. He scored a then-school record 24 touchdowns during Hillsdale’s undefeated season of 1955, a record that stood for 56 years. In his three seasons in the backfield, he rushed for 2,248 yards, a career record that stood for 34 years. He led the nation in scoring in 1955, was team co-captain in 1956 and was twice named Little All-American by the Associated Press.
